IF you have already looked at the web sites torrents search page, and if on each of the torrent rows there is no freeleech flag of any kind, then there is nothing the indexer can use to indicate a freeleech in its processed results.
If however you can see such a flag on the torrent rows, let us know by providing an HTML dump of the page, and we can add that detection to the indexer. See https://github.com/Jackett/Jackett/wiki/Troubleshooting#how-to-provide-html-source

I will raise an enhancement ticket to see if we can implement global freeleech detection, because this is a common issue across many sites running different engines, and I believe it should be possible to support this with cardigann.

OK. I think i understand what you are saying.
So I will change the indexer so that it always uses the search for name, and I will change the config Search for freeleech option into a Filter for freeleech option, so that a search on the web site always uses the search in the name option, and once results are returned, the indexer will drop any results that are not gold if you have chosen to use the config filter freeleech option.
